Monthly contract: The monthly contract refers to a type of contract where full months are charged. In this case, if the guest moves into a place on a date other than the first day of the month, he will still be charged for the entire month and not just for the nights he booked. This directly impacts the contract start date, which will always be the first day of the month.
The type of deposit applicable is selected by the landlord. A Security Deposit refers to the amount you have to pay directly to your landlord on the day of your move-in to cover for any potential damages that may occur during your stay. The landlord may also keep the Security Deposit if you leave earlier than agreed. If no damages occur and you leave on the agreed move-out date, your deposit will be refunded.
